With a Delta E of 34.8,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Orange hue family. RAL 410-3 has a warm temperature while RAL 140-3 has a neutral temperature. RAL 140-3 is brighter with an LRV of 80.1 compared to 23.5 for RAL 410-3. RAL 140-3 is more saturated (74%) than RAL 410-3 (61%).
